Cluster Switch Removal/Installation

  1. Disconnect the negative battery terminal. (See NEGATIVE BATTERY TERMINAL DISCONNECTION/CONNECTION (US) .)
  2. Remove the following parts:
    1. Driver-side front scuff plate (See FRONT SCUFF PLATE REMOVAL/INSTALLATION .)
    2. Driver-side front side trim (See FRONT SIDE TRIM REMOVAL/INSTALLATION .)
    3. Driver-side decoration panel (See DECORATION PANEL REMOVAL/INSTALLATION .)
    4. Passenger-side decoration panel (See DECORATION PANEL REMOVAL/INSTALLATION .)
    5. Hood release lever (See HOOD RELEASE LEVER AND RELEASE CABLE REMOVAL/INSTALLATION (US) .)
    6. Driver-side lower panel (See LOWER PANEL REMOVAL/INSTALLATION (US) .)
  3. Disconnect the connectors.

  4. With the hooks pressed in the direction of arrows (1) shown in the figure, push out the cluster switch No. 1 in the direction of arrow (2) and remove it from the driver-side lower panel.

  5. With the hooks pressed in the direction of arrows (1) shown in the figure, push out the cluster switch No. 2 in the direction of arrow (2) and remove it from the driver-side lower panel.
  6. Install in the reverse order of removal.
